  • Patent number: 8836569
    Abstract: A synthetic aperture radar's surveillance is defeated by electronic camouflage that employs a protective shield to cover an intended target. The shield intercepts and modifies the interrogating radar pulses by modulating incident radar pulses to produce radar echoes shifted in Doppler frequency, whereby the returned echoes give a false depiction of the target, even to smearing the radar display. New structures are presented that exhibit variable reflectivity and variable dielectric characteristics of particular use in the foregoing and other electronic systems.

  • Patent number: 6252541
    Abstract: Novel test mounts are defined for a radar cross section testing apparatus that allows a supported object to be tested without interference from the test mount. This includes prescribing a diameter of about 0.61 wavelegths for a cylindrical test mount; maintaining a ratio for the test mount's characteristic dielectric constant and magnetic permeability of about one; and/or installing a frequency transposing apparatus to convert the frequency of radar pulses directed toward the test mount to off-frequency echoes.

  • Patent number: 5847672
    Abstract: Microwave devices incorporate at least one photosensitive baffle that is selectively illuminated changing the baffle's electronic characteristic from being transparent to being reflective of microwave energy. The baffle serves as a gate, tuning element, reflector and the like. Various forms of photosensitive baffles and microwave devices are presented.

  • Patent number: 5689262
    Abstract: Microwave devices incorporate at least one photosensitive baffle that is selectively illuminated, changing the baffle's electronic characteristic from being transparent to microwave energy to being reflective thereof. That action selectively alters an electronic characteristic of the microwave device. The effect is shown applied in a number of devices, including a back lobe antenna. Undesired back lobes occuring at a principal frequency are reduced in a back plane antenna by alternately coupling and decoupling an extension to the antenna's back plane at a rate sufficiently high enough to shift the back lobes to adjacent frequencies. A photoelectrically controlled baffle suitably serves as the extension.
